As a Licensed Professional Counselor, I can support you by integrating Solution Focused Brief Therapy (SFBT), Reality Therapy, and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T). With SFBT, we can collaboratively identify your existing strengths and resources, shifting focus from the problem to what you want to be different and exploring "exceptions" when the problem is less severe, fostering hope and achievable goals. Reality Therapy can empower you to assess your current choices and behaviors in relation to your needs, helping you determine if your actions are truly serving your best interests and encouraging you to make more effective choices. Finally, CBT techniques can assist you in recognizing and challenging distorted thought patterns (e.g., self-blame, hopelessness) and developing healthier coping mechanisms and communication strategies, thereby reducing your emotional distress and improving your ability to interact constructively with the situation.
